Course Content
- Research Methods in Industrial and Organizational Psychology
- Organizational Behavior
- Psychological Assessment in the Workplace
- Leadership and Management
- Employee Training and Development
- Work Motivation and Job Attitudes
- Diversity in the Workplace
- Performance Appraisal and Feedback
- Occupational Health Psychology
- Ethics in Industrial and Organizational Psychology
Assessment
The assessment is done via submission of assignment. There are no written exams.

Career path
| Career Opportunity | Description |
|---|---|
| Human Resources Assistant | Support HR functions such as recruitment, training, and employee relations using I/O psychology principles. |
| Organizational Development Specialist | Design and implement programs to enhance organizational effectiveness and employee engagement. |
| Training Coordinator | Develop training materials and programs to improve employee skills and performance based on psychological theories. |
| Employee Relations Consultant | Resolve workplace conflicts, conduct investigations, and provide guidance on employee relations issues. |
| Performance Management Analyst | Analyze and improve performance appraisal systems and processes to drive employee productivity and motivation. |
